Paramount Pictures’ reboot of The Saint has found its lead.
Chris Pine, who can be seen next in Wonder Woman: 1984, is in talks to star in the studio’s remake of Robin Hoodesque film. The reboot will be directed by Rocketman helmer Dexter Fletcher from a script penned by Seth Grahame-Smith.
The Saint is based on a 1920s book series of the same name by Leslie Charteris. It inspired a 1960s TV show starring Roger Moore and was turned into a film in 1997 starring Val Kilmer.
According to Variety, Paramount Pictures views the reboot as a potential start for an ongoing feature franchise, however, due to the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ic shutting down almost all productions, it’s unknown when The Saint will actually happen.
